3. Which historical figure is known for linking cholera to contaminated water in
s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3




s3 London (1854)? s3




a) Louis Pasteur
s3 s3




b) Edward Jenner
s3 s3




c) John Snow
s3 s3




d) Robert Koch
s3 s3




Answer: c s3




Explanation: John Snow, a British physician, mapped cholera cases during an
s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3




s3 outbreak and traced the source to a public water pump on Broad Street. His work
s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3




s3 is a foundational example of epidemiologic methods and disease prevention.
s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3

5. Which U.S. event marked the beginning of modern public health as a
s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3




s3 governmental responsibility? s3




a) The American Revolution
s3 s3 s3

, b) The Civil War
s3 s3 s3




c) The Great Depression
s3 s3 s3




d) The 1798 Marine Hospital Service (later USPHS)
s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3




Answer: d s3




Explanation: The Marine Hospital Service, established in 1798, provided care for
s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3




s3 merchant seamen and evolved into the U.S. Public Health Service. It was the first
s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3




s3 federal health agency, signaling government’s role in protecting population health.
s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3 s3
